Bidirectional water supply and drainage system suitable for large water supply pump station
The invention provides a bidirectional water supply and drainage system suitable for a large water supply pump station, which comprises a differential pressure transmitter arranged on a bypass pipe of a cooler; the cooler is provided with a cooler water supply pipe, a cooler water supply bypass pipe, a cooler drainage pipe and a cooler drainage bypass pipe; the cooler water supply pipe is communicated to the water inlet side of the cooler, and the cooler water supply bypass pipe is communicated to the water drainage side of the cooler; the cooler drainage pipe is communicated to the drainage side of the cooler, and the cooler drainage bypass pipe is communicated to the water inlet side of the cooler; the cooler water supply pipe, the cooler water supply bypass pipe, the cooler water drainage pipe and the cooler water drainage bypass pipe are each provided with an electric valve and a service valve, and the multiple electric valves are matched to achieve forward water inflow or directional water inflow of the cooler. The invention can effectively solve the problems of sediment deposition and aquatic organism attachment of the cooler pipeline, and ensures the reliability of a pump station technology water supply system.
